Philadelphia, PA Weather on August 27
August 27th in Philadelphia, PA typically brings warm summer weather, with average highs around 85°F and lows near 70°F. Over 54 years of records, the warmest August 27th was in 1993 (87°F average), while the coldest was 1987 (68°F) — a 19°F range across recorded history. Rain or other precipitation has occurred on about 20% of August 27th dates historically, with the wettest August 27th recording 5.73" of rain. Temperatures on this date have remained relatively stable over the past several decades.
